Understanding the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ide

As you age, your body’s natural production of certain hormones can decline. This specific compounded prescription helps stimulate your pituitary gland. It encourages a more natural, pulsatile release of your own growth hormone. This mechanism differs significantly from direct growth hormone administration.

The therapy acts as a grow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H) analog. It signals your body to produce more of what it already makes. The Role of IGF-1

Insulin-like Growth Factor 1, or IGF-1, is a crucial biomarker. It directly reflects your body’s growth hormone levels. Your clinician monitors IGF-1 to assess treatment effectiveness. This helps ensure the therapy is working as intended.

Optimizing IGF-1 levels can impact various bodily functions. It plays a role in muscle growth, bone density, and metabolism. Maintaining healthy levels contributes to overall wellness. This lab marker provides objective data for your care.

Safety, Compliance, and Cost in Caledonia

This growth hormone releasing peptide is a compounded medication. It is not FDA-approved as a standalone drug. Compounding pharmacies operate under sections 503A and 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. These sections allow for personalized medication preparation.

What about side effects?

Reported side effects are generally mild and include injection site redness, transient flushing and occasional headache. Sermorelin uses your own pituitary gland, which tends to be safer than synthetic HGH because the body retains its natural feedback loop.
